US Zika Virus Testing Market Overview
As per MRFR analysis, the US Zika Virus Testing Market Size was estimated at 27.72 (USD Million) in 2023. The US Zika Virus Testing Market Industry is expected to grow from 31.5(USD Million) in 2024 to 65 (USD Million) by 2035. The US Zika Virus Testing Market CAGR (growth rate) is expected to be around 6.807% during the forecast period (2025 - 2035).

US Zika Virus Testing Market Drivers
Increasing Awareness of Zika Virus Transmission and Effects
The rising awareness about Zika Virus and its transmission is a significant driver for the US Zika Virus Testing Market Industry. Public health organizations like the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) have highlighted the risks associated with Zika Virus, particularly its potential to cause severe birth defects such as microcephaly in infants when pregnant women are infected.
According to the CDC, approximately 1 in 10 infants in the US may be born with Zika-related birth defects if the mother is infected during pregnancy.This alarming statistic is raising awareness and prompting pregnant women to seek testing, thus contributing to market growth. Furthermore, educational campaigns have been implemented to inform the public on protecting themselves from mosquito bites, which serves to underline the importance of testing for Zika Virus and drives more individuals towards getting tested.

Zika Virus Testing Market Tests Include Insights
The US Zika Virus Testing Market demonstrates a growing focus on various testing methodologies, particularly in the Tests Include segment, which comprises diverse options such as serological testing, specifically Zika virus antibody tests, and molecular testing, including nucleic acid amplification techniques. Serological testing plays a critical role in identifying past infections through the detection of specific antibodies in the bloodstream, crucial for understanding population immunity and exposure levels.
This method is particularly significant due to its practical applications in epidemiological studies, where broad screening can inform public health responses to outbreaks.On the other hand, molecular testing methods like nucleic acid amplification are vital for diagnosing active infections, offering high sensitivity and specificity. This type of testing is increasingly preferred in clinical settings because it enables timely intervention and management of affected individuals, contributing to decreased transmission rates.

US Zika Virus Testing Market Industry Developments
The US Zika Virus Testing Market has seen notable developments, particularly due to increased awareness of arboviral diseases. In March 2023, Hologic introduced an innovative molecular diagnostic test enhancing the speed of detection for Zika and other pathogens, improving patient outcomes and efficiency in healthcare settings. LabCorp and Quest Diagnostics have expanded their testing capabilities to meet rising demands, especially as Zika virus concerns intertwined with other mosquito-borne viruses like West Nile and dengue.
The valuation of the market is also boosted by strategic investments in Research and Development by companies such as Roche Diagnostics and Abbott Laboratories. In May 2023, Meridian Bioscience announced a collaboration with Cepheid to enhance Zika virus testing efficiency further. Notably, in January 2022, Genetic Engineering Institute expanded its product line to include serological tests for Zika virus, showcasing a commitment to addressing emerging health threats.
As public health agencies continue to monitor Zika transmission pathways, the market is likely to grow, driven by the participation of organizations like BioReference Laboratories and Alere in research initiatives focused on new testing methodologies.
